Product Description
Qualcomm Snapdragon 400 quad-core processor With 1.2GHz processor speed, an Adreno 305 450MHz GPU and 1GB LPDDR2 RAM. Android 4.3 Jelly Bean operating system 3G speed Provides fast Web connection for downloading apps, streaming content and staying connected with social media. Wi-Fi 802.11b/g/n network Mobile hotspot capability lets you extend wireless access to compatible devices. Google Chrome for Mobile browser lets you easily surf the Web. Bluetooth 4.0 technology Allows wireless communication with a Bluetooth-enabled device. 4.5" HD Display touch screen With 329 ppi and 1280 x 720 resolution offers clear visuals and helps simplify navigation of features and content. Corning Gorilla Glass helps safeguard your phone's display against scratches. 8GB internal memory Provides ample storage space for your contacts, music, apps and more. Google Drive offers 15GB of storage space, so you can access data on the go. Rear-facing camera 5.0MP (4:3) or 3.8MP (16:9) resolution and clear videos with 720p resolution at 30 fps. The 1.3MP front-facing camera makes it easy to shoot self-portraits and videos. CrystalTalk dual-microphone noise cancellation Ensures clear audio transfer. SplashGuard nano coating Protects your phone from moisture infiltration in the elements. Motorola Assist Helps prevent disruptions while you're driving or sleeping. FM Radio app Allows you to enjoy listening to your favorite programming with most wired headphones (not included). Preloaded apps Include Gmail, Google Maps, Google Drive, Google Calendar, Google+, YouTube, My Verizon Mobile, Backup Assistant Contacts, NFL Mobile, VZ Navigator, VerizonTones and more. Voice Actions Let you use Google Search by simply speaking commands. Up to 18 hours of talk time and up to 15 days of standby time* With the included 2070 mAh battery, ensuring your phone remains operational throughout the day. * Battery life is based on a typical user profile that includes both usage and standby.Product Details

If you want a budget Android phone look no further. I was using another $99 prepaid Android phone and it was painful to say the least. Slow, bug ridden etc. This phone allows you to have a mid range phone for a low end price. The Moto G completely blows away all other phones in it's price range and many that are retail for $200-$300!
Since Google owns Motorola you're able to get this phone at a great price AND has a guaranteed update to KitKat! The ONLY downside is the 8GB storage and no microSD slot. Personally, I am not a heavy app user or gamer and I transfer my photos to my laptop often as well as switch out my music. If 8GB isn't enough room the phone also comes with 50GB of Google drive storage free for two years.
This phone truley is "The phone for the rest of us"!

Value and tech wise this phone is currently hands down the best smartphone available for the prepaid / no-contract market.
Recently updated with the newest Android OS (KitKat) and a quad-core processor it is blazingly fast and smooth to operate. HD screen is vibrant and slick. The size and form factor is perfect for me in that it is neither too small nor stupidly huge.
Some very minor negatives:
No MicroSD memory expansion (but phone comes with 50GB Google Drive space)
1GB RAM (phone can get a little laggy if you open up a bunch of apps and leave them running in the background. Solution - close apps you are not currently using)
For some reason the phone back cover feels a little slippery. This can be solved by getting an inexpensive aftermarket phone case (worth while to protect your investment anyway)
Not a true negative of the phone itself but just an FYI - Verizon keeps its no-contract phones restricted to 3G. But honestly not a issue for me as their 3G service in my area is good and fast.
BOTTOM LINE: At $100, loaded with current tech and features, the Moto G is an excellent value for a no-contract plan.
